Job Description

What will you do?

  • Apply your past business development experience for prospecting, and lead generation, to new and existing clients
  • Provide an exceptional client experience by delivering superior business and financial advice within a Client Relationship Team model
  • Collaborate and coordinate with a core group of expert advisors to create and execute a client contact strategy tailored to each client’s needs
  • Demonstrate portfolio management and risk mitigation through the review of financial statements identifying trends, monitoring risk, and assessing for credit restructuring
  • Leverage the expertise of RBC by identifying referral opportunities, making introductions together with appropriate referrals to RBC partners

What do you need to succeed?

Must-have

  • Minimum 3-5 years commercial banking experience
  • Deep and proven client-centricity, business development, and relationship management excellence
  • Exceptional interpersonal, communication, negotiation and presentation skills
  • New client acquisition skills (i.e., pitching the value proposition, lead generation, initial customer contact and cold calling, asking for referrals)
  • Experience with emerging communications and technology (i.e., web-based meetings, social media, Digital Banking and Mobile Applications)

Nice-to-have

  • Experience in supporting Health Care Professionals
  • Credit skills including assessment of risk and financial analysis, credit structuring/solutions and presenting the deal
  • Specialized industry expertise in a past role (e.g., real estate, healthcare, agriculture)
  • University degree, ideally in commerce, business administration, or related experience
